See the License for the specific language governing permissions and limitations under the License. */ package handlers import ( "net/http" utilnet "k8s.io/apimachinery/pkg/util/net" "k8s.io/apiserver/pkg/audit" "k8s.io/apiserver/pkg/endpoints/metrics" apirequest "k8s.io/apiserver/pkg/endpoints/request" ) const ( maxUserAgentLength = 1024 userAgentTruncateSuffix = "...TRUNCATED" ) // lazyTruncatedUserAgent implements String() string and it will // return user-agent which may be truncated. type lazyTruncatedUserAgent struct { req *http.Request } func (lazy *lazyTruncatedUserAgent) String() string { ua := "unknown" if lazy.req != nil { ua = utilnet.GetHTTPClient(lazy.req) if len(ua) > maxUserAgentLength { ua = ua[:maxUserAgentLength] + userAgentTruncateSuffix } } return ua } // LazyClientIP implements String() string and it will // calls GetClientIP() lazily only when required. type lazyClientIP struct { req *http.Request } func (lazy *lazyClientIP) String() string { if lazy.req != nil { if ip := utilnet.GetClientIP(lazy.req); ip != nil { return ip.String() } } return "unknown" } // lazyAccept implements String() string and it will // calls http.Request Header.Get() lazily only when required. type lazyAccept struct { req *http.Request } func (lazy *lazyAccept) String() string { if lazy.req != nil { accept := lazy.req.Header.Get("Accept") return accept } return "unknown" } // lazyAuditID implements Stringer interface to lazily retrieve // the audit ID associated with the request. type lazyAuditID struct { req *http.Request } func (lazy *lazyAuditID) String() string { if lazy.req != nil { return audit.GetAuditIDTruncated(lazy.req.Context()) } return "unknown" } // lazyVerb implements String() string and it will // lazily get normalized Verb type lazyVerb struct { req *http.Request } func (lazy *lazyVerb) String() string { if lazy.req == nil { return "unknown" } return metrics.NormalizedVerb(lazy.req) } // lazyResource implements String() string and it will // lazily get Resource from request info type lazyResource struct { req *http.Request } func (lazy *lazyResource) String() string { if lazy.req != nil { ctx := lazy.req.Context() requestInfo, ok := apirequest.RequestInfoFrom(ctx) if ok { return requestInfo.Resource } } return "unknown" } // lazyScope implements String() string and it will // lazily get Scope from request info type lazyScope struct { req *http.Request } func (lazy *lazyScope) String() string { if lazy.req != nil { ctx := lazy.req.Context() requestInfo, ok := apirequest.RequestInfoFrom(ctx) if ok { return metrics.CleanScope(requestInfo) } } return "unknown" }
